Market Growth Projections
The Global Dental Soft Tissue Regeneration Market Industry is projected to experience substantial growth in the coming years. With an estimated market value of 1.76 USD Billion in 2024, it is expected to reach approximately 3.05 USD Billion by 2035. This growth trajectory suggests a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.12% from 2025 to 2035. Such projections indicate a robust demand for soft tissue regeneration solutions, driven by factors such as technological advancements, increasing prevalence of dental diseases, and a growing focus on aesthetic dentistry. The market's expansion reflects the evolving landscape of dental care and the importance of regenerative therapies.
Rising Geriatric Population
The global increase in the geriatric population is a significant factor driving the Global Dental Soft Tissue Regeneration Market Industry. As individuals age, they are more susceptible to dental issues, including gum disease and tooth loss. The World Health Organization projects that the number of people aged 60 years and older will reach 2.1 billion by 2050. This demographic shift necessitates effective dental care solutions, including soft tissue regeneration therapies. Consequently, the market is poised for growth as healthcare providers seek to address the unique dental needs of older adults, ensuring that they maintain optimal oral health.

Increasing Prevalence of Periodontal Diseases
The rising incidence of periodontal diseases globally is a primary driver for the Global Dental Soft Tissue Regeneration Market Industry. As more individuals experience gum-related issues, the demand for effective regenerative treatments escalates. According to recent estimates, periodontal disease affects nearly 50% of adults over 30 years old. This growing prevalence necessitates innovative solutions, leading to an anticipated market value of 1.76 USD Billion in 2024. The need for advanced therapies to restore gum health and prevent tooth loss is likely to propel the market forward, highlighting the importance of soft tissue regeneration in dental care.
Technological Advancements in Regenerative Techniques
Technological innovations in regenerative dentistry significantly influence the Global Dental Soft Tissue Regeneration Market Industry. The introduction of advanced biomaterials, growth factors, and tissue engineering techniques enhances the efficacy of soft tissue regeneration procedures. For instance, the development of collagen-based scaffolds and stem cell therapies offers promising results in tissue healing and regeneration. These advancements not only improve patient outcomes but also expand the range of available treatment options. As a result, the market is projected to grow, reaching an estimated value of 3.05 USD Billion by 2035, reflecting the ongoing evolution of dental regenerative technologies.
